Federal government reaches deal to triple Pfizer doses

Federal government reaches deal to triple Pfizer doses to one million per week Australia has reached a deal to triple its access to Pfizer COVID-19 vaccines to one million doses a week from July 19. Jonathan TalbotDeputy Editor July 9, 2021 - 10:05AM Doses of Pfizer will be tripled to one million per week from July 19, Prime Minister Scott Morrison announced on Thursday.  The Prime Minister also announced the rapid acceleration of the vaccination program in Sydney including 150,000 extra doses of Pfizer and 150,000 AstraZeneca vaccines.  The Commonwealth’s deal with Pfizer will provide Australia’s supply chains with approximately one million doses a week from July 19 – three times the average of 300,000 to 350,000 jabs a week during May and June.
